Tilray Brands (TSX:TLRY) has revealed its 420-themed product lineup for 2024.

Tilray’s Good Supply, Redecan, Broken Coast, Solei, Mollo and XMG brands will hold a series of educational 420 budtender events across Canada in partnership with more than 1,000 cannabis retailers. During the events, attendees will learn about a new range of products designed to commemorate the yearly celebration of cannabis culture.

Flower

  • Good Supply‘s Melon Dream is a sweet sativa-leaning hybrid featuring a mix of fruit and diesel aromas heavy on the terpenes. Find it in Ontario and Alberta.
  • Broken Coast‘s Cherry Cheesecake delivers cherry, cheesy and sour aromas, while EmergenZ bursts with flavours of tangerine, citrus, grapefruit and pine. Find them in Ontario, Alberta and British Columbia.
  • Redecan‘s Space Age Cake is a potent hybrid (Girl Scout Cookies x Snow Lotus) with notes of vanilla, nuts and ammonia available in straight-cut, hemp-wrapped pre-rolls. Find it in Ontario, Alberta and British Columbia in 3.5 g and 14 g packages.

Beverages

  • XMG‘s non-carbonated Banana Brain-Freeze leans into tropical sweetness while Berry Rocket is a bright fusion of juicy berries. Both contain 10 mg of THC, 10 mg of CBG and guarana extract in a 355 ml can. Find them in Ontario and Alberta with expected expansion nationwide.
  • Solei‘s cold brews in Peach Cranberry and Wildberry Hibiscus were created with black tea and true-to-fruit juice blends. Peach Cranberry contains 5 mg of THC and 10 mg of CBG, while Wildberry Hibiscus contains 5 mg of THC and 10 mg of CBD. Both are available in Ontario and set to be released nationwide, with Peach Cranberry also available in British Columbia.
  • Mollo’s seltzers in lemon, mango and pineapple contain 10 mg of THC and 20 mg of CBG formulated with nano-emulsified cannabinoids without any cannabis aftertaste. Find all three in Ontario and eventually across the country, with mango and pineapple also currently available in British Columbia.

Pre-rolls

  • Good Supply’s Cherry on Top blunts come in a two-pack, one of which contains Cosmic Cherry (sativa), enhanced with added lemon sweetness, while the other showcases Golden Drizzle (indica), which is notable for its blend of sweet and caramelized notes. Find them in Ontario and Alberta, followed by an upcoming nationwide launch.
  • Redecan Hemp’d Khalifuel Redees are filled with a premium indica cross (Khalifa Mints x Grape Gasoline) rolled into 10 x 0.4 g straight-cut joints. Find them in Ontario, Alberta and British Columbia.
  • Canaca‘s Darts Berries & Cream and Twisted Citrus strains blend strong natural flavours with high potencies that “will have you wondering what makes these secret recipes so good,” according to Thursday’s news release. Both are available in Alberta, with Berries and Cream also available in British Columbia.
  • Broken Coast’s Cherry Cheesecake (Kimbo Kush x Cherry Pie) offers dramatic purple and orange indica buds flooded with milky trichomes and amber pistils, all of which are enveloped in a cherry, cheese and sour flavour profile. Find them in 5 x 0.5 g packs in Ontario, Alberta and British Columbia.

Vapes

  • Good Supply’s Gooey Gold and Cherry Loops balance high potency and rich flavours through a slick ceramic core, glass cartridge and hemp mouthpiece setup. Gooey Gold is highlighted by its sweet caramel flavour, while Cherry Loops combines a unique blend of cherry, fruity and citrus notes. Find them in Ontario, Alberta and British Columbia.

About Tilray Brands

Tilray Brands is a global cannabis lifestyle and consumer packaged goods company operating in Canada, the United States, Europe, Australia and Latin America. Notable in-house brands besides those mentioned above include Hexo, Original Stash, Bake Sale, Chowie Wowie, RIFF, Symbios and Navcora.

Tilray stock (TSX:TLRY) is up by 2.21 per cent, trading at C$3.92 per share as of 11:21 am ET. The stock has added approximately 15 per cent year-over-year, but has lost 80.4 per cent since 2021.
